Saints Secure Bresee, Eye Singleton: A Defensive Rebound in the Making

The New Orleans Saints have exercised the fifth-year option on defensive tackle Bryan Bresee, securing his services for next season at around $12.7 million. This move comes after Bresee showed promise with four sacks and solid run stops last year. Meanwhile, the team is reportedly interested in Nebraska defensive back DeShon Singleton, particularly at safety, where they need depth. Singletons ball-hawking skills, evidenced by his four interceptions in college, have caught the Saints scouts attention. Fans and analysts are optimistic about Bresees potential, hoping he stays healthy and performs at the level of his Clemson days. The Saints front office seems to share this optimism, betting on Bresee to anchor their defensive line amidst rebuild talks. On the draft front, edge rusher Rueben Bain Juniors shorter arms have raised concerns, potentially impacting his draft stock. With these moves, the Saints appear to be strategically positioning themselves for a defensive rebound this offseason.
